<title>Providing for consideration of the Resolution (H. Res. 72) removing a certain Member from certain standing committees of the House of Representatives.</title>
<summary summary-id="id117hres91v53" currentChamber="HOUSE" update-date="2021-04-19">
<action-date>2021-02-04</action-date>
<action-desc>Passed House</action-desc>
<summary-text><![CDATA[<p>This resolution sets forth the rule for consideration of H.Res. 72 (removing Representative Marjorie Taylor Greene from the House Committee on the Budget and the House Committee on Education and Labor).</p>]]></summary-text>

<dc:description>This file contains bill summaries for federal legislation. A bill summary describes the most significant provisions of a piece of legislation and details the effects the legislative text may have on current law and federal programs. Bill summaries are authored by the Congressional Research Service (CRS) of the Library of Congress. As stated in Public Law 91-510 (2 USC 166 (d)(6)), one of the duties of CRS is "to prepare summaries and digests of bills and resolutions of a public general nature introduced in the Senate or House of Representatives".
